Transaction 115696f018963fae5fba93424455475d25c6891a4ef1da52829d42f5bb552d46

1 Input
2 Outputs
  • 115696f018963fae5fba93424455475d25c6891a4ef1da52829d42f5bb552d46:0
  • value  381000
    address  171tf9Nv5VLyyvkgDGm2Kk16hWhiyHmLSK
  • 115696f018963fae5fba93424455475d25c6891a4ef1da52829d42f5bb552d46:1
  • value  68957062
    address  1GDcWLrEz4ubN9vm7CeUkWYfXJVnb6ioZ8